Title: Innovations by David L. Morse in Glass Technology

Introduction

David L. Morse, based in Corning, NY, is a notable inventor with a remarkable portfolio of 32 patents. His work primarily focuses on advancements in glass technology, particularly in developing specialized glass products with enhanced properties.

Latest Patents

Among his latest inventions, Morse has created a coated, antimicrobial, chemically strengthened glass. This innovative glass possesses antimicrobial properties and features a low surface energy coating that does not interfere with these properties. The glass is designed to have an Ag ion concentration on the surface ranging from greater than zero to 0.047 µg/cm. This invention has practical applications in settings such as hospitals and laboratories, where the cleanliness of surfaces is paramount.

Another noteworthy patent from Morse is a photochromic glass with a sharp cutoff. This glass integrates a modified boroaluminosilicate base and utilizes a nanocrystalline cuprous halide phase as a photochromic agent. This unique combination allows the glass to exhibit a sharp cutoff in the UV or short wavelength visible spectrum, alongside an absorption capability at longer wavelengths. The innovative property of absorbing visible light facilitates a photochromic transition, making this glass particularly versatile without compromising its sharp cutoff.
